Responsibilities include (But Are Not Necessarily Limited To):
Identify/design potential solutions using the SharePoint out of the box interface. Identify/design potential solutions requiring customization.
Migrate SharePoint 2013 site and implement Office 365 Intranet site (test and production) including any necessary security configurations
Create and migrate forms/ documents; create document approval/review workflow tracking and reporting requests, submissions, approvals, budget obligations, receipts
Design user-friendly workflow/application to document and route requests
Configure SharePoint sites using out of the box capabilities and manage user permissions.
Evaluate the interface between hardware and software, operational requirements, and characteristics of the overall system
Test documents and maintain system corrections
Leverage the use and application of technical principles, theories, and concepts and develop solutions to routine technical problems of limited scope.
Train stakeholders on administering, operating and updating the system
Basic Qualifications:
BA or BS degree in Engineering, Computer Science, or Management Information Systems
3+ years of experience as a SharePoint developer
2+ years of experience migrating from SharePoint on premise to Office 365
Experience developing custom workflows for Office 365 utilizing Microsoft Power Apps
1+ years of experience with JavaScript, including JQuery or Angular, HTML, and CSS
1+ years of experience with Confluence or JIRA a Plus
Experience developing customer applications using SharePoint
Experience with architecting and implementing business solutions in SharePoint
Ability to write PowerShell scripts for SharePoint development and maintenance
Ability to communicate effectively with a diverse group of internal and external stakeholders
Ability to obtain and maintain security clearance
Must be a U.S. Citizen to obtain the necessary security clearance
Nice to Have:
Federal government consulting experience
Microsoft Certifications in SharePoint, and Office 365
